Dear Readers, This is a good news for you all that if you have lost or forget your Aadhaar card number then you can find it online by using following steps:
1. Click on the following link https://resident.uidai.net.in/find-uid-eid or simple type " search Aadhar card by mobile number" on www.google.com
2. After clicking on the above link, you will find out a one form that will look like below picture-
3. In this form, You have to enter your name, your registered email id or registered mobile number and security code shown in the form. After that click on the get OTP button then you will get OTP number on your registered mobile number.
4. Finally type OTP number on the box "Enter OTP" shown in the form and then click on "Verify OTP".
After doing all steps, you will get your Aadhaar card number on your registered mobile number as a message. Also you can download your Aadhaar card.
